Job Summary
Responsible for the installation, maintenance, calibration, troubleshooting, safety, and proper functioning of all biomedical equipment used in the hospital. The role ensures equipment availability, patient safety, regulatory compliance, and timely preventive maintenance.
Key Responsibilities
- Manage all biomedical equipment across OPD, OT, diagnostics, wards, and other departments.
- Perform preventive and breakdown maintenance of medical equipment.
- Coordinate with vendors/service engineers for equipment servicing and repairs.
- Maintain equipment-wise service, calibration, warranty, AMC and breakdown records.
- Ensure regular calibration and performance checks of critical equipment.
- Inspect newly purchased equipment before installation and commissioning.
- Monitor equipment downtime and ensure timely resolution.
- Maintain an updated Biomedical Equipment Asset Register.
- Train staff on safe and proper usage of biomedical equipment.
- Ensure electrical and equipment safety standards are followed.
- Coordinate with departments to identify equipment-related issues.
- Support procurement by providing technical specifications and vendor comparisons.
- Monitor AMC/CMC renewal dates and service schedules.
- Ensure proper documentation for audits and hospital accreditation requirements.
- Maintain spare-parts inventory and coordinate replacement when required.
- Report major equipment failures and recurring problems to management.
- Ensure proper disposal/decommissioning procedures for obsolete equipment.
Key Equipment – Eye Hospital
Experience with ophthalmic equipment such as:
- Slit Lamps
- Auto Refractometers / Keratometers
- OCT
- Fundus Cameras
- Visual Field Analyzer
- A/B Scan
- Optical Biometers
- Phaco Machines
- Operating Microscopes
- Autoclaves / ETO equipment
- Patient Monitors
- ECG and other diagnostic equipment

Key Performance Indicators (KPIs)
- Equipment uptime
- Preventive maintenance completion %
- Breakdown response and resolution time
- Calibration compliance %
- Reduction in repeated equipment failures
- AMC/CMC compliance
- Accuracy of biomedical equipment records
- Department satisfaction with equipment support
